WebSep 16, 2024 · The vine produces flowers on wood that was produced during the previous year’s growing season. This one-year-old wood is typically thinner and lighter in color, and more flexible than the old-old wood. Wisteria blooms each spring and goes dormant in the fall. ( Echinacea, Zones 3 to 9) Coneflowers have become a garden staple for their easygoing nature. Growing 2 to 5 feet high and 2 feet wide, these resilient flowers are the perfect companion plant in just about any garden. See more ideas about crochet bouquet, diy crochet projects, flowers. porterhouse steak san mateoWebNov 27, 2010 · The dieffenbachia may bloom with a flower that looks much like a calla lily. The problem is that the plant will usually die once it is finished blooming. However, by the time a dieffenbachia is ready to bloom, it will almost always have new side shoots growing from it, which you can take to grow a new plant. open source wifi spectrum analyzer
